Saludos, he tenidos problemas para configurar el subassemblies Conditional CutOrFill, poseo un perfil tipo que corresponde al ensache de la calzada al costado izquierdo solamente el cual debe tener una terraza si la zona de corte es mayor a 10 metros, el talud de corte es 1:2 (H:V) las dimensiones de la terraza es 4 metros de ancho para posteriormente interceptar la superficie. Realice mi assembly de la siguiente manera:
1° Condicion:
Side: Left
Type: Cut
Layout Grade: 1.000:1
Layout Width: 8.00
Maxime Distance: 9999.000
Minime Distance: 10.000
A continuación adjunto MultiLink con los siguientes parametros
Side: Left
No of Links: 2
Link Codes: Top, Datum
Point Codes: MultiLink_Point
Shape Codes: MultiLink
dW1: 5.000
dZ1: 10.000
dW2: 4.000
dZ2: -0.120
Para finalizar LinkSlopeToSurface
Side: Left
Slope: 200%
Add Link in: Cut
Point Codes: P2
Link Codes: Top, Datum
Omit Link: No
2° Condicion:
Side: Left
Type: Cut
Layout Grade: 2.000:1
Maxime Distance: 9.999
Minime Distance: 0.000
A continuación adjunto LinkSlopeToSurface
Side: Left
Slope: 200%
Add Link in: Cut
Point Codes: P2
Link Codes: Top, Datum
Omit Link: No
Teniendo como resultado obtengo corte que tienen mas de 10 metros de altura, no dibuja la terraza que me piden, solo dibuja la segunda condición.
Desde ya muchas gracias.
¡Resuelto! Ir a solución.
Resuelto por joantopo. Ir a solución.
Resuelto por joantopo. Ir a solución.
He actualizado el link en el mediafire con el nuevo fichero pero mismo nombre.
http://www.mediafire.com/download/vyfa4hzcmyldrcf/TaludConBermaDesmonte.pkt
Yo aconsejo hacer estos pasos antes:
-Seleccionar el ensamblaje y eliminar el subensamblaje este. Pulsar Aplicar y recargas la obra lineal.
-Te vas a la paleta de herramientas, seleccionas mi subensamblaje y "eliminar".
(si quieres,cierra el dibujo y lo vuelves a abrir, aunque no hace falta).
-Importas de nuevo el fichero pkt y le indicas la superficie tal como muestra la imagen de antes.
Saludos.
Algo similar me sucedia a mi y mi solución fue que estaba ingresando los codigos erroneamente pues segun yo para que pueda generar la obra lineal necesita conectar puntos y lineas que programas con el SAC y la descripción o asignación de los codigos las tienes que colocar con comas (") por ejemplo para este caso de taludes necesitas un codigo que identifique donde estaria tu linea de ceros y la forma de nomabrar este codigo debe ser "ceros" esto aplica para point, link y shape en los ensambles que tiene civil cargados por default lo llaman "DATUM" tal vez lo conveniente sea que si vas a conbinar este ensamble con otro que trae civil, llames a los codigos "DATUM" de esta forma te conectara todas las secciones que coloca a lo largo de tu obra lineal. Ahora bien no estoy seguro si a partir de la version 2014 ya no necesites las comas pero de entrada yo todas las secciones que programo con SAC siempre cumplo esta regla y nunca me han fallado.
Si te reconoce el ensamble en tu version de civil, quiere decir que no es el problema, el lenguaje que utiliza SAC esta basado en NET y por lo general si lo trabajas en el mismo SO no tienes problemas de version, otra anecdota que me sucedio fue que programe un ensamble con SAC en W8 y cuando la ejecutaba en W7 me desestabilizaba el civil 3D y algunos casos me decia que civil no tenia instalada la libreria correspondiente a este ensamble y que no lo podia utilizar.
Saludos y espero haber contribuido un poco.
Por lo que me han respondido en el foro en inglés, las versiones de SAC no sirven hacia atrás.
Es decir, si está hecho con el SAC 2014, no sirve en Civil 3D 2013.
Y respecto a los códigos, va entre comillas si es el código, pero se pueden poner variables de usuario de tipo string que al ponerlas en el SAC para cada código de punto o de vínculo, obviamente no van con comillas porque son variables.De esta forma, al ser variables de usuario (input parameters), el usuario puede corregir el código(texto).
Lo que me gustaría probar, es una última cosa (que en principio tampoco debería funcionar):
Tener el dwg y ponerle yo el subensamblaje con Civil 3D 2014, pasarle de nuevo el archivo y que lo abra en 2013, a ver qué le dice el programa..
Hola Joan, en post anteriores te adjunte el archivo dwg. Y gracias nuevamente por tu ayuda. De todas formas vuelvo a adjuntar el archivo.
¿No encontraste lo que buscabas? Pregúntale a la comunidad o comparte tus conocimientos.